Dragons improve mark to 19-0

4 min read

MARTINSBURG -- Jonah Snowberger threw a one-hit, three-inning shutout as Central topped Bishop Guilfoyle Catholic, 15-0, and improved to 19-0, in high school baseball Wednesday.

Paxton Kling doubled, tripled and drove in two runs, Jeff Hoenstine had two hits and three RBIs, Devon Boyles had a pair of doubles, Hunter Smith doubled and drove in two and Parker Gregg had two hits and two RBIs.

Panthers win two

REVLOC -- Penn Cambria swept a pair of close games from Bishop Carroll, 9-6 and 8-6, with the help of two big games from Vinny Chirdon.

Chirdon had five hits in the doubleheader and seven RBIs with three doubles.

Luke Repko doubled three times and had three RBIs for the Huskies.

NBC beaten

McCONNELLSBURG -- McConnellsburg scored nine runs in the bottom of the sixth inning to end what had been a close game against Northern Bedford, 15-5.

Ben Gable doubled among his two hits for the Black Panthers.

Tigers toppled

CLEARFIELD -- Hollidaysburg dropped to 4-9 with a 7-4 loss at Clearfield.

The Golden Tigers, down 7-1 after four innings, got three hits and two runs scored from Joe Bukosky to go with two hits and two RBIs from Nate Sell.

Clearfield (5-9) got a grand slam from Blake Preetash.
